Game Provider Comparison: NetEnt vs Microgaming

When evaluating software providers in the online gaming industry, NetEnt and Microgaming stand out as two of the most prominent names. Both companies boast a robust portfolio of games, but they differ significantly in terms of technology, game variety, and volatility. This article will provide an in-depth comparison of these two giants, focusing on their game mechanics, volatility levels, and the technology behind their platforms.

Game Variety

NetEnt and Microgaming offer extensive game libraries, each with unique characteristics and themes. Let’s take a closer look at how they compare:

  • NetEnt: Known for its high-quality graphics and innovative gameplay, NetEnt provides an impressive selection of over 200 games. Popular titles include Starburst, Gonzo’s Quest, and Dead or Alive II. The company excels in creating visually stunning slots with engaging storylines.
  • Microgaming: With a staggering collection of over 1,200 games, Microgaming holds the title for the largest online casino game provider. Their offerings include iconic games like Thunderstruck II, Immortal Romance, and a wide array of progressive jackpot slots like Mega Moolah.

Volatility

Volatility is a crucial aspect that affects a player’s gaming experience and potential payouts. Understanding the volatility of games helps players select games that suit their risk preferences:

Provider Low Volatility Medium Volatility High Volatility
NetEnt Starburst Gonzo’s Quest Dead or Alive II
Microgaming Thunderstruck II Game of Thrones Immortal Romance

NetEnt is renowned for its medium to high volatility games, often providing larger payouts but with less frequent wins. On the other hand, Microgaming caters to a broader audience by offering a balanced mix of low, medium, and high volatility games. This variety allows players to pick games that align with their risk tolerance.

Technology Behind the Platforms

The technology that powers these gaming giants is a significant factor in their success:

  • NetEnt: Utilizes cutting-edge HTML5 technology, allowing for seamless gameplay across desktop and mobile devices. Their games are designed with a focus on user experience, featuring responsive designs and high-quality graphics. NetEnt also employs a proprietary random number generator (RNG) to ensure fair play.
  • Microgaming: Pioneered the first online casino software in 1994 and continues to lead in technology. Their Quickfire platform enables rapid game development and distribution, providing operators access to a vast array of games. Microgaming’s use of advanced RNG technology guarantees fairness and transparency.

Both NetEnt and Microgaming have made significant investments in their technology, ensuring that players enjoy not only an extensive selection of games but also an engaging and reliable gaming experience.
